You Are NOT Your Performance With Coach Paul Woodside
Coach Paul Woodside saved my kicking career as a high school specialist who couldn't get out of his own way. I came across Paul in a book, A Few Seconds of Panic, by Wall Street Journal reporter Stefan Fatsis as he chronicled his experiences as a Denver Broncos training camp kicker. To prep for the experience Fatsis discovered Paul. While I never met Paul, his words coached be powerfully enough through the book - I learned how to get out of my own way, relax and ultimately enjoy kicking more. Woodside's philosophy of kicking really isn't about kicking, but life and the quest to separate one's self worth from their performance with who they are as a person. Last Chance U Coach John Mosely
What's up Coach Nation, Coach Cahill here to discuss how to build player relationships with Last Chance U's JUCO Basketball Coach John Mosely. Somewhat of a breakout star after Netflix's most recent season of its highly acclaimed Last Chance U series, Coach Mosely brings a wealth of experience to his coaching. Originally with designs on playing pro basketball, Coach Mosely was bit by the coaching buy while on a missions trip to Brazil, found college basketball and now is head coach at ELAC.
